Superman's Pal, Jimmy Olsen #56
In "The Son of Jimmy Olsen!", the latest chapter in the Olsen family saga sees Jimmy Olsen, Jr. and Lola Kent ready to marry—only to face a roadblock from Lola’s father, Clark Kent, who fears their union might be doomed by Lola’s latent powers. Determined to prove himself, Jimmy Jr. concocts a serum that grants him superpowers, even sharing it with Lola’s mother, Lois, who gains abilities of her own. But just as the couple prepares to elope, Lex Luthor throws a wrench into their plans with a sinister wedding gift that strips them of their powers. Written by Jerry Siegel and illustrated by Kurt Schaffenberger, with a striking cover by Curt Swan and John Forte, this 1961 classic blends romance, sci-fi, and superhero antics in a way only DC could deliver.

Jimmy Olsen, Jr. and Lola Kent fall in love and wish to get married. Lola’s father, Clark Kent, says “no” to the marriage due to concerns that Lola has superpowers and Jimmy Olsen, Jr. does not. Despite Lola’s parents opposing the marriage, Jimmy Jr. and Lola elope, but only after Jimmy Jr. has crafted a serum that gives him superpowers. In addition, Jimmy Jr. shares the serum with Lola’s mother, Lois, who also gains superpowers. Lex Luthor, however, gums up the works with a wedding “gift” that robs Jimmy Jr. and Lois of their newfound abilities.
